Output deb23f092d26b0e7b513a9e39ee7b5e3b7b43f793ef9b5181a958a30ce287e3b:0

value
43488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baf344e228be689f6960768310163a64540e98b OP_EQUAL
address
MDLjzA6HLQFezF8QTJf5dceyuWqd5GSbBR
transaction
deb23f092d26b0e7b513a9e39ee7b5e3b7b43f793ef9b5181a958a30ce287e3b
spent
true